5 Drink Cover Ideas for Outdoor Summer Entertaining

Mojito on a hot summer afternoon?  Yes, please!  Frozen daiquiri by the pool?  Absolutely!  Bug in my Vodka-Lemonade?  No, thank you!

As much as I love summer cocktail parties, I can't stand bugs, especially pesky gnats swarming around my drink.  How can we keep them out?  A drink cover!  Check out these 5 clever ideas ...

Baking cups ... this is genius!

A square napkin embellished with beads or tassels ... looks sophisticated!

Fabric atop a mason jar ... it's like Family Reunion chic!

 
One of my favorites ... easy-to-make, with so many color options!

And the original drink cover ... tapas! 
I like this option for corporate or networking events.  It not only looks great but the concept helps guests juggle glasses and plates when seating is limited.
